Job Description

We are seeking a skilled and detail-oriented Temporary Assistant Controller to support our Finance team during a critical period. This full-time, non-benefited position will begin in June and is expected to last approximately 20 weeks. The Temporary Assistant Controller will play an important role in maintaining the accuracy and integrity of financial operations, contributing to key accounting processes, and ensuring timely reporting. Reporting to the Controller, the Temporary Assistant Controller coordinates the internal control, accounting and tax activities of the Academy, including the annual financial statement audit, to provide accurate and useful financial and related data for Academy users. The pay range for this position is $30
  • 40/hour commensurate with experience.
Primary Duties and Responsibilities Oversee the timely and accurate reporting of financial data in accordance with policies, laws, regulations and generally accepted accounting principles. Assist with the annual financial statement audit process and preparation of financial statements Provide analysis and resolution of complex accounting and GAAP reporting issues Supervise general ledger maintenance, and changes to funds and accounts Manage cash transactions and controls Assist with annual external benchmarking surveys, and Academy data and budget analyses Manage and document accounting controls, policies, and procedures, and ensure compliance with auditing standards and external regulatory requirements Collaborate with the Manager of Endowment and Infrastructure Accounting to ensure the timely and accurate reporting of depreciable fixed assets, gifts, and endowment data Other duties as assigned Perform other duties as assigned Job Specifications Bachelor's degree required, Master's degree and/or CPA preferred 3
  • 5 years' experience, preferably in not-for-profit industry including a strong understanding of not-for-profit financial statements.
Public accounting experience is highly desired High degree of professional character and ethical standards in the performance and delegation of duties required Demonstrated proficiency and familiarity with a database accounting environment and spreadsheet software fluency A high level of integrity and a strong work ethic Excellent verbal and written communication and organizational skills Ability to perform detailed research and troubleshooting Demonstrated desire and ability to be a team player and collaborate with others successfully Demonstrated commitment to diversity and inclusion and to serving the needs of a diverse community; Ability to manage, and sensitivity to, highly confidential information Physical Demands Close visual acuity to view a computer terminal Ability to sustain substantial movements of the wrists, hands and/or fingers Special Instructions for Applicants Application materials must include: A cover letter summarizing interests and qualifications A complete resume or curriculum vitae Working Conditions The worker is in an office environment, and is not substantially exposed to adverse environmental conditions.
